Dreamweaver 8.0.2 is the current version and is the only one available for sale from reputable vendors (including Adobe).

The history of Dreamweaver releases (from Wikipedia):

– Dreamweaver 1.0 (Released December 1997; Dreamweaver 1.2 followed in March 1998)
– Dreamweaver 2.0 (Released December 1998)
– Dreamweaver 3.0 (Released December 1999)
– Dreamweaver UltraDev 1.0 (Released June 2000)
– Dreamweaver 4.0 (Released December 2000)
– Dreamweaver UltraDev 4.0 (Released December 2000)
– Dreamweaver MX (Released May 2002)
– Dreamweaver MX 2004 (Released September 10, 2003)
– Dreamweaver 8 (Released September 13, 2005)
– 8.0.2 updater patch released (Released 9 May 2006)
